This tool lets you open and read Microsoft Word .docx files directly in your web browser — no Microsoft Word, no Google account, no installation required. Simply drag and drop your file and the content appears instantly.
It uses mammoth.js, an open-source JavaScript library, to convert the DOCX XML structure into clean HTML that renders in your browser. Your document is never sent to any server.
